۰۸-شهریور-۱۳۸۶, ۲۰:۳۰:۵۹
دوستان سلام
نیازمند یاری سبزتان هستم ...
من کتاب تالیف کردم و چون ارائش بصورت مکتوب با توجه به شرایطی که ناشران دارند برام بصرفه و معقول نبود تصمیم گرفتم اون رو بر روی سی دی بصورت نرم افزاری ارائه بدم...
متن حدودا 400 صفحه هست و در یک فایل ورد تایپ شده.
قصد من اینه که متن این کتاب (که البته مصور هم هست) رو جوری ارائه بدم که فقط قابل نمایش و پرینت باشه و نشه ازمتنش کپی گرفت و فایلش رو در اختیار دیگری گذاشت.
این روش ها رو امتحان کردم تا الان:
1)خوب روش معمول اینه که فایل متن ورد بصورت PDF در بیاد و بعد ما فایل PDF ساخته شده رو درش عملیات کپی و انتخاب متن رو غیر فعال بکنیم.بعد این فایل روی سی دی رایت بشه و واسه اینکه نشه از رو سی دی کپیش کرد اونو رو سی دی با نرم افزارهایی مثل CDSecure یا WINISO و یا TZ مخفی کرد و واسش مسیر مجازی گذاشت.
این روش مناسب نیست.چون فایل مخفی شده رو راحت میشه با نرم افزارهایی مثل IsoBuster کپی کرد.
نظر شما چیه؟؟؟
2)روش دیگه اینه که اون رو درون یه زبان برنامه نویسی بیاریم و قفل هایی نرم افزاری مثل Activitation رو روش اعمال کنیم.فایل EXE و پکیج رو در نهایت روی سی دی رایت کنیم.
واسه آوردن فایل ورد مثلا روی یه فرم در وی بی میشه از کنترل OLE Object استفاده کنیم.و سپس فایل ورد رو نه بصورت لینک که فایل اصلی رو بخوا بلکه بصورت Embed شده وارد این کنترل کنیم.و سپس ویرایش فایل رو غیر فعال کنیم در زمان اجرا...
این روش هم قابل استفاده نیست.چون کنترل OleObject در کمال تعجعب متن و عکس های فایل ورد رو کامل میاره اما قابلیت اسکرول کردن و رفتن به صفحات بعدی رو نداره.
3)گویا برنامه نویسان وی بی هم به فکر این قضیه بودن. توی کامپوننت های وی بی یه کامپوننتی به نام:
Microsoft Word Picture
وجود داره.این کنترل هم مختص فایل ورده.و نمایش اون تو وی بی هستش اما باز هم اسکرول نداره ...
دوستان من که دیگه روشی به ذهنم نمیرسه
لطفا کمک کنید...
پیشاپیش دست گلتون درد نکنه.
نیازمند یاری سبزتان هستم ...
من کتاب تالیف کردم و چون ارائش بصورت مکتوب با توجه به شرایطی که ناشران دارند برام بصرفه و معقول نبود تصمیم گرفتم اون رو بر روی سی دی بصورت نرم افزاری ارائه بدم...
متن حدودا 400 صفحه هست و در یک فایل ورد تایپ شده.
قصد من اینه که متن این کتاب (که البته مصور هم هست) رو جوری ارائه بدم که فقط قابل نمایش و پرینت باشه و نشه ازمتنش کپی گرفت و فایلش رو در اختیار دیگری گذاشت.
این روش ها رو امتحان کردم تا الان:
1)خوب روش معمول اینه که فایل متن ورد بصورت PDF در بیاد و بعد ما فایل PDF ساخته شده رو درش عملیات کپی و انتخاب متن رو غیر فعال بکنیم.بعد این فایل روی سی دی رایت بشه و واسه اینکه نشه از رو سی دی کپیش کرد اونو رو سی دی با نرم افزارهایی مثل CDSecure یا WINISO و یا TZ مخفی کرد و واسش مسیر مجازی گذاشت.
این روش مناسب نیست.چون فایل مخفی شده رو راحت میشه با نرم افزارهایی مثل IsoBuster کپی کرد.
نظر شما چیه؟؟؟
2)روش دیگه اینه که اون رو درون یه زبان برنامه نویسی بیاریم و قفل هایی نرم افزاری مثل Activitation رو روش اعمال کنیم.فایل EXE و پکیج رو در نهایت روی سی دی رایت کنیم.
واسه آوردن فایل ورد مثلا روی یه فرم در وی بی میشه از کنترل OLE Object استفاده کنیم.و سپس فایل ورد رو نه بصورت لینک که فایل اصلی رو بخوا بلکه بصورت Embed شده وارد این کنترل کنیم.و سپس ویرایش فایل رو غیر فعال کنیم در زمان اجرا...
این روش هم قابل استفاده نیست.چون کنترل OleObject در کمال تعجعب متن و عکس های فایل ورد رو کامل میاره اما قابلیت اسکرول کردن و رفتن به صفحات بعدی رو نداره.
3)گویا برنامه نویسان وی بی هم به فکر این قضیه بودن. توی کامپوننت های وی بی یه کامپوننتی به نام:
Microsoft Word Picture
وجود داره.این کنترل هم مختص فایل ورده.و نمایش اون تو وی بی هستش اما باز هم اسکرول نداره ...
دوستان من که دیگه روشی به ذهنم نمیرسه
لطفا کمک کنید...
پیشاپیش دست گلتون درد نکنه.